Jimoh Ibrahim Not Our Member - Ondo State PDP

Reacting to the business mogul,  Jimoh Ibrahim's picking of the Governorship nomination form to contest in the governorship election in On do State,  the Ondo State chapter of the Peoples Democratic Party, PDP,  has come out to say on Thursday that  Mr. Jimoh Ibrahim, was not a member of the party.


Jimoh picked the nomination form to contest from the factional National Chairman of the party, Senator Ali Modu Sheriff in Abuja on Thursday.


The Ondo PDP insisted that the businessman was a member of the Accord Party in the state and not a member of the PDP as he claimed.


The Director of Media and Publicity of the PDP in the state, Mr. Ayo Fadaka stated this while reacting to a report that Jimoh has obtained the governorship nomination form in Abuja.


Fadaka said, “I can confirm to you that Jimoh Ibrahim is not a member of our party, the PDP, he has since been rid of his membership and we all know that he is a bonafide member of the Accord Party.


“So, for him not to be making a somersault to pick a form of PDP is a shameless thing anybody can do in this situation.



”Also I want to confirm to you again that Jimoh Ibrahim, apart from the fact that he is not a member of our party, he does not have any relationship with the PDP in any case; and if he is taking a form from Sheriff, he confirms to the entire world where Sheriff is coming from “
